WebNov 15, 2024 · Start by drilling small pilot holes at least 2″ away from each side of the crack. Then fasten the washers with 2″ screws. To repair moving cracks in plaster, secure the loose or high side of the crack with plaster washers before filling in the crack. Rob Leanna based on Kathy Bray. WebDec 17, 2024 · A crack is more serious when it’s between five and 15 millimeters wide (0.5 to 1.5 centimeters, or up to half an inch) as the cause could be more serious than simply dried out plaster or a house that is settling. A damaged wall would be considered severe when it’s 25 millimeters or wider (2.5 centimeters or one inch) as it could be a sign ...
